Worm:Win32/Pizbot.gen
Detected by Microsoft Defender Antivirus
Aliases: Backdoor.Win32.IRCBot.aro (Kaspersky) W32/Sdbot.worm (McAfee)
Summary
Worm:Win32/Pizbot is a family of worms that spread via P2P file sharing networks. They also function as a backdoor that allows unauthorized access and control of an affected machine via IRC.
